Commercial & Industrial Status of Iron Pipe Fittings

In the contemporary landscape of residential construction and commercial HVAC (Heating, Ventilation, and Air Conditioning) engineering, the reliance on high-quality iron pipe fittings remains absolute. Despite the proliferation of synthetic alternatives like PEX, PVC, and CPVC, iron—particularly malleable cast iron, carbon steel, and specialized alloy derivatives—maintains an unshakeable foothold. The global market for industrial and residential metal piping solutions is experiencing a robust resurgence, driven by increasingly stringent building codes, fire safety regulations, and the demand for infrastructure with a lifespan exceeding 50 years.

Commercially, the integration of iron pipe fittings in residential plumbing and HVAC is shifting from traditional commodity purchasing to highly specified, engineering-driven procurement. Modern HVAC systems, which rely heavily on chilled water loops, high-pressure steam heating, and radiant floor matrices, require materials with a low coefficient of thermal expansion. Iron fittings provide unparalleled dimensional stability, ensuring that mechanical joints, threaded connections, and butt-welded seams do not suffer from fatigue failure due to continuous temperature cycling. This reliability translates to significantly reduced maintenance costs and zero-leakage guarantees for property developers and facility managers.

🌡️ Thermal Resilience in HVAC

Iron fittings are indispensable in boiler rooms and steam distribution networks. Unlike plastics, which can warp or degrade under high temperatures, alloy and carbon steel fittings maintain their structural integrity at extreme temperatures, ensuring the safe transport of superheated steam and chilled refrigerants.

🛡️ Superior Fire Safety

In residential plumbing, fire safety is paramount. Iron pipe fittings are non-combustible. In the event of a structural fire, they do not melt, collapse, or emit toxic fumes, thereby maintaining the integrity of water supply lines critical for fire suppression systems.

In-Depth Application Scenarios

1. High-Pressure HVAC Chilled Water Systems

In large-scale residential complexes, centralized HVAC systems utilize chilled water to regulate indoor climates. The transportation of this chilled water requires robust piping networks capable of withstanding constant hydraulic pressure and preventing condensation-induced exterior corrosion. Specialized iron pipe fittings, particularly those treated with advanced anti-corrosion coatings or manufactured from nickel-copper alloys (such as UNS N04400), are deployed at critical junctions. Flanges, elbows, and tees made from high-grade iron ensure smooth directional flow, minimizing pressure drops and maximizing the energy efficiency of the chiller plants.

2. Residential Gas Distribution Networks

Safety is the ultimate metric in residential gas distribution. Black malleable iron pipe fittings are the gold standard for natural gas and propane lines within homes. The precision threading of these fittings ensures a hermetic seal when combined with appropriate pipe dopes or Teflon tapes. Their high tensile strength protects the gas lines from physical impacts, seismic shifts, and accidental damage during home renovations, effectively eliminating the risk of catastrophic gas leaks.

3. Hydronic Radiant Heating Systems

Modern luxury residences frequently employ hydronic radiant heating. While the underfloor loops may utilize flexible tubing, the primary manifolds, heat exchangers, and boiler connections rely exclusively on iron and steel fittings. Socket-welding pipe fittings and heavy-duty flanges are utilized to connect the boiler to the distribution manifold. The high thermal mass of iron acts as a buffer, stabilizing water temperatures before it enters the delicate sub-floor networks, thereby enhancing the overall comfort and efficiency of the HVAC system.
